Light in Flavour

When you want a delicate sweetness in your baking, using White Sugar or Caster Sugar can provide a subtle sweetness that enhances the other flavours without overpowering them.

Fruity

Using fruit can add a natural, fruity sweetness to baking, creating a refreshing, light flavour or adding sweet tartness. White Sugar or Caster Sugar in baking, allows the flavour of the fruit to shine and Jam Setting Sugar preserves the taste of fruit in vibrant jams.

Nutty

Coconut Sugar bring a subtle nuttiness to baked goods, elevating the taste with a mild, natural sweetness and pairs beautifully with tropical flavours.

Spiced

Using sugars with spices like cinnamon, ginger, licorice or chai can lend a warm, aromatic sweetness to baking.

Caramel

Utilising brown sugars or incorporating caramelised sugar syrups creates a richer, deeper flavor profile, adding a hint of caramel or toffee-like taste.

Chocolate

Chocolate adds a decadent richness to baked goods with its deep cocoa flavour, making it perfect for indulgent treats. Try adding a deep flavoured Brown Sugar to the mix for enhanced chocolate flavour.

Banana Animal Pancakes
Banana Animal Pancakes

Banana Animal Pancakes

10 mins
20 mins
Easy
4
Keep my screen awake
  • Ingredients
  • Method
Ingredients
  • 1 cup wholemeal self-raising flour
  • ¼ cup Chelsea Icing Sugar
  • 1 ripe banana, mashed
  • ½ cup milk
  • 1 x 50g egg, whisked
  • 40g butter, melted
  • 1 tsp vanilla essence
  • Cooking spray
  • Extra 20g butter, to cook
  • Extra Chelsea Icing Sugar to serve

Method
Put flour and Chelsea Icing Sugar in a medium bowl and stir. Put banana, milk, egg, butter and vanilla essence in a bowl, and whisk to combine. Add banana mixture to flour mixture and mix until just combined.
Heat a little of the extra butter in a large non-stick frying pan. Spray 3 metal animal cutters (about 7cm diameter) with cooking spray and place in the frying pan. Add 1 tablespoon of the mixture to each of the cutters and spread out over the base of the cutter. Cook for 2 mins or until bubbles appear on the surface. Use a small knife to loosen the cutter and remove. Turn over the pancake and cook for a further 1 min. Transfer pancakes to a plate and wrap in a clean towel to keep warm.
Repeat to cook the remaining pancakes, greasing the pan as needed and spraying the cutters in between batches.
Dust pancakes with extra Chelsea Icing Sugar, to serve.
